#include "drmP.h"

#define DEBUG_SCATTER 0

void drm_sg_cleanup(drm_sg_mem_t *entry)
{
	free(entry->virtual, M_DRM);
	free(entry->busaddr, M_DRM);
	free(entry, M_DRM);
}

int drm_sg_alloc(DRM_IOCTL_ARGS)
{
	DRM_DEVICE;
	drm_scatter_gather_t request;
	drm_sg_mem_t *entry;
	unsigned long pages;

	DRM_DEBUG( "%s\n", __FUNCTION__ );

	if ( dev->sg )
		return EINVAL;

	DRM_COPY_FROM_USER_IOCTL(request, (drm_scatter_gather_t *)data,
			     sizeof(request) );

	entry = malloc(sizeof(*entry), M_DRM, M_WAITOK | M_ZERO);
	if ( !entry )
		return ENOMEM;

	pages = round_page(request.size) / PAGE_SIZE;
	DRM_DEBUG( "sg size=%ld pages=%ld\n", request.size, pages );

	entry->pages = pages;

	entry->busaddr = malloc(pages * sizeof(*entry->busaddr), M_DRM,
	    M_WAITOK | M_ZERO);
	if ( !entry->busaddr ) {
		drm_sg_cleanup(entry);
		return ENOMEM;
	}

	entry->virtual = malloc(pages << PAGE_SHIFT, M_DRM, M_WAITOK | M_ZERO);
	if ( !entry->virtual ) {
		drm_sg_cleanup(entry);
		return ENOMEM;
	}

	entry->handle = (unsigned long)entry->virtual;

	DRM_DEBUG( "sg alloc handle  = %08lx\n", entry->handle );
	DRM_DEBUG( "sg alloc virtual = %p\n", entry->virtual );

	request.handle = entry->handle;

	DRM_COPY_TO_USER_IOCTL( (drm_scatter_gather_t *)data,
			   request,
			   sizeof(request) );

	DRM_LOCK();
	if (dev->sg) {
		DRM_UNLOCK();
		drm_sg_cleanup(entry);
		return EINVAL;
	}
	dev->sg = entry;
	DRM_UNLOCK();

	return 0;
}

int drm_sg_free(DRM_IOCTL_ARGS)
{
	DRM_DEVICE;
	drm_scatter_gather_t request;
	drm_sg_mem_t *entry;

	DRM_COPY_FROM_USER_IOCTL( request, (drm_scatter_gather_t *)data,
			     sizeof(request) );

	DRM_LOCK();
	entry = dev->sg;
	dev->sg = NULL;
	DRM_UNLOCK();

	if ( !entry || entry->handle != request.handle )
		return EINVAL;

	DRM_DEBUG( "sg free virtual  = %p\n", entry->virtual );

	drm_sg_cleanup(entry);

	return 0;
}
